Queen Letizia Took Her Monochrome Look to a Whole New Level — Thanks to 1 Tiny Detail

Like most stylish royals, Queen Letizia always manages to give polished, professional looks a bit of personal flair. But while we're used to her swapping blazers for capes or rocking leather pants, her latest ensemble proves that even the most modest and classic of styles can be fun, too. It just depends on how you style them.

Attending a presentation for FameLab España 2016 Scientific Monologues, Letizia opted to go navy on navy, pairing a midlength skirt with a matching top. But rather than keeping her outfit super simple, a single throwback detail — a subtle peplum design — really took things to the next level, accentuating her waist and making us want to revisit the trend.
